StudySync is an educational software suite created by BookheadEd Learning, LLC that specializes in web-based educational content, peer-to-peer student exercises and the use of original video content for middle school, high school and college-level education.

Contents

StudySync was created by Robert Romano in partnership with Jay King in Sonoma County, California, USA.

Product Features

  • "Sync.TV" – A broadcast-quality web series in which actors playing college and high school students construct meaning from selected texts through informal, collaborative discussions.
  • "Sync-Library" – A collection of over 300 classic and modern texts, writing prompts, and other media.
  • "Sync-Review" – A feature in which students post and critique each other's work through an interactive peer network.
  • "Sync-Lessons" – Lessons that range across disciplines include Sync.TV videos combined with critical thinking aids and prewriting prompts.
  • "Sync-Binder" – Personal portfolios for students that contain all student work conducted with the software program, including essays, prewriting work, and reviews.
  • "Sync-Management" – Classroom management tools that allow teachers to make individual, group, or whole class assignments.
  • "Sync-Assessment" – Assessment tools that allow teachers to track student progress.
  • "Sync-Blasts" – Teacher-controlled prompts on current events sent out to students' PDAs, iPhones and e-mail. Responses are posted for peer review and rating.
  • Awards

    2011 EDDIE Award

    Cool Tool Award from Edtech Digest for Collaboration Solutions

    2011 Readers’ Choice Top 100 Products in District Administration Magazine

    “Best of Class” from the Interactive Media Awards

    Top 101 Best Report Card Solutions on HowToLearn.com

    CODiE nomination for "Best K-12 Instructional Solution."

    Trendsetter Award from EdTech Digest

    2012 BESSIE Awards for "Internet Tools Website" and "Language Arts/Integrated Learning Website"

    Finalist in the Innovation Award category of the 2012 Association of Educational Publishers (AEP) Awards
